คำถามติดแท็ก string

สตริงเป็นลำดับที่ จำกัด ของสัญลักษณ์ที่ใช้กันทั่วไปสำหรับข้อความแม้ว่าบางครั้งสำหรับข้อมูลโดยพลการ

6
สตริงการแยก Android
ฉันได้สตริงเรียกและอยู่ในรูปแบบของบางสิ่งบางอย่างเช่นนี้CurrentString ฉันต้องการแยกการใช้เป็นตัวคั่น ดังนั้นวิธีที่คำจะถูกแยกออกเป็นสตริงของตัวเองและจะเป็นสตริงอื่น แล้วฉันก็อยากจะใช้2 ที่แตกต่างกันเพื่อแสดงสตริงที่"Fruit: they taste good"CurrentString:"Fruit""they taste good"SetText()TextViews อะไรจะเป็นวิธีที่ดีที่สุดในการเข้าถึงสิ่งนี้
227 java  android  string 


14
เป็นไปได้ไหมที่จะอัพเดตสตริงของสตอรีบอร์ดที่แปลแล้ว
ฉันแปลส่วนหนึ่งของแอปพลิเคชันของฉันด้วยการสร้างกระดานเรื่องราว base.lproj และไฟล์สตริง 3 ไฟล์สำหรับมัน เมื่อเดือนก่อนและหลังจากนั้นฉันเพิ่มตัวควบคุมมุมมองใหม่ลงในแอป แต่ปุ่มและป้ายกำกับของตัวควบคุมนี้ไม่ปรากฏในไฟล์สตริง เป็นไปได้ไหมที่จะอัปเดตไฟล์สตริงสตอรีบอร์ด 3 ไฟล์ที่แนบมานี้หรือฉันต้องเพิ่มการแปลสตริงใหม่โดยใช้โปรแกรมโดยใช้ NSLocalizableString และ Localizable.strings

3
ความคิดเห็น“ Frozen_string_literal: true” ทำอะไรได้บ้าง
นี่คือrspecbinstub ในไดเรกทอรีโครงการของฉัน #!/usr/bin/env ruby begin load File.expand_path("../spring", __FILE__) rescue LoadError end # frozen_string_literal: true # # This file was generated by Bundler. # # The application 'rspec' is installed as part of a gem, and # this file is here to facilitate running it. # require "pathname" ENV["BUNDLE_GEMFILE"] ||= File.expand_path("../../Gemfile", …


13
เชลล์สคริปต์ - ลบอัญประกาศแรกและสุดท้าย (") ออกจากตัวแปร
ด้านล่างนี้เป็นตัวอย่างของเชลล์สคริปต์จากสคริปต์ที่ใหญ่กว่า มันลบคำพูดจากสตริงที่ถือโดยตัวแปร ฉันกำลังใช้ sed แต่มีประสิทธิภาพหรือไม่ ถ้าไม่เช่นนั้นวิธีที่มีประสิทธิภาพคืออะไร? #!/bin/sh opt="\"html\\test\\\"" temp=`echo $opt | sed 's/.\(.*\)/\1/' | sed 's/\(.*\)./\1/'` echo $temp
225 string  bash  shell  unix  sed 

8
วิธีการแยกหนึ่งสายออกเป็นหลายสายโดยคั่นด้วยช่องว่างอย่างน้อยหนึ่งช่องในเปลือกหอย
ฉันมีสตริงที่มีหลายคำอย่างน้อยหนึ่งช่องว่างระหว่างแต่ละสอง ฉันจะแยกสตริงออกเป็นแต่ละคำเพื่อให้สามารถวนซ้ำได้อย่างไร สตริงถูกส่งเป็นอาร์กิวเมนต์ ${2} == "cat cat file"เช่น ฉันจะวนซ้ำมันได้อย่างไร นอกจากนี้ฉันจะตรวจสอบว่าสตริงมีช่องว่างได้อย่างไร
224 bash  shell  string  split 

12
PHP - เชื่อมต่อหรือแทรกตัวแปรในสตริงโดยตรง
ฉันสงสัยว่าอะไรคือวิธีที่เหมาะสมในการแทรกตัวแปร PHP ลงในสตริง? ทางนี้: echo "Welcome ".$name."!" หรือด้วยวิธีนี้: echo "Welcome $name!" PHP v5.3.5ทั้งสองวิธีการเหล่านี้ทำงานในของฉัน หลังนี้สั้นกว่าและเรียบง่ายกว่า แต่ฉันไม่แน่ใจว่ารูปแบบแรกนั้นดีกว่าหรือเป็นที่ยอมรับว่าเหมาะสมกว่าหรือไม่

6
แทนที่หนึ่งอักขระด้วยอักขระอื่นใน Bash
ฉันต้องสามารถทำได้คือแทนที่ช่องว่าง ( ) ด้วยจุด ( .) ในสตริงในทุบตี ฉันคิดว่ามันจะค่อนข้างง่าย แต่ฉันใหม่ดังนั้นฉันจึงไม่สามารถหาวิธีแก้ไขตัวอย่างที่คล้ายกันสำหรับการใช้งานนี้
223 string  bash  replace 

22
เอาช่องว่างทั้งหมดออกจากสายอักขระใน SQL Server
วิธีที่ดีที่สุดในการลบช่องว่างทั้งหมดออกจากสตริงใน SQL Server 2008 คืออะไร LTRIM(RTRIM(' a b ')) จะลบช่องว่างทั้งหมดที่ด้านขวาและด้านซ้ายของสตริง แต่ฉันต้องลบช่องว่างตรงกลางด้วย

5
std :: string_view เร็วกว่า const std :: string & อย่างไร
std::string_viewได้ทำให้มันไปที่ C ++ 17 const std::string&และจะมีการใช้กันอย่างแพร่หลายในการใช้มันแทน เหตุผลหนึ่งคือประสิทธิภาพ ใครสามารถอธิบายได้ว่า std::string_view / จะเร็วกว่าconst std::string&เมื่อใช้เป็นชนิดพารามิเตอร์อย่างไร (สมมติว่าไม่มีสำเนาใน callee)
221 c++  string  c++17  string-view 

11
ความแตกต่างระหว่าง String replace () และ replaceAll ()
ความแตกต่างระหว่าง java.lang.String replace()กับreplaceAll()วิธีการอื่นที่ไม่ใช่ภายหลังใช้ regex คืออะไร สำหรับการทดแทนอย่างง่ายเช่นแทนที่.ด้วย/ จะมีความแตกต่างหรือไม่?
221 java  string  replace 

8
ตรวจสอบว่าสตริงลงท้ายด้วยหนึ่งในสตริงจากรายการ
วิธีการเขียนแบบต่อเนื่องของไพ ธ อนคืออะไร? extensions = ['.mp3','.avi'] file_name = 'test.mp3' for extension in extensions: if file_name.endswith(extension): #do stuff ฉันมีหน่วยความจำที่คลุมเครือว่าการประกาศforลูปที่ชัดเจนสามารถหลีกเลี่ยงและเขียนในifสภาพ มันเป็นเรื่องจริงเหรอ?
220 python  string  list 

27
วิธีที่ง่ายกว่าในการสร้างพจนานุกรมของตัวแปรที่แยกกัน?
ฉันต้องการรับชื่อตัวแปรเป็นสตริง แต่ฉันไม่รู้ว่า Python มีความสามารถในการวิปัสสนามากขนาดนั้นหรือไม่ สิ่งที่ต้องการ: >>> print(my_var.__name__) 'my_var' ฉันต้องการทำเช่นนั้นเพราะฉันมีตัวแปรมากมายที่ฉันต้องการเปลี่ยนเป็นพจนานุกรมเช่น: bar = True foo = False >>> my_dict = dict(bar=bar, foo=foo) >>> print my_dict {'foo': False, 'bar': True} แต่ฉันต้องการบางสิ่งที่เป็นอัตโนมัติมากกว่านั้น Python มีlocals()และvars()ดังนั้นฉันเดาว่ามีวิธี
220 python  string  variables 

19
ฉันจะใส่สตริงลงในอาร์เรย์โดยแบ่งเป็นบรรทัดใหม่ได้อย่างไร
ฉันมีสตริงที่มีตัวแบ่งบรรทัดในฐานข้อมูลของฉัน ฉันต้องการแปลงสตริงนั้นเป็นอาร์เรย์และสำหรับทุกบรรทัดใหม่ให้กระโดดหนึ่งดัชนีในอาร์เรย์ หากสตริงคือ: My text1 My text2 My text3 ผลลัพธ์ที่ฉันต้องการคือ: Array ( [0] => My text1 [1] => My text2 [2] => My text3 )
220 php  string  line-breaks 

โ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.